Oregon Heritage Vitality Survey - The Oregon Heritage Commission is requesting that all those engaged with heritage preservation related work in Oregon please take the 2024 Oregon Heritage Vitality Study survey<https://oregon.qualtrics.com/jfe/form/SV_6fG1c61ZwGuyzMq> now open through Feb. 2. The goal of this study is to better understand the current state of Oregon’s heritage sector and to help the Oregon Heritage Commission and statewide partners and entities target solutions – such as specific policies and resources — for sustaining and boosting heritage-related work in Oregon. We need your help! Please take about 30 minutes to share information about your organization’s operations and concerns. Your survey response is critical to the success of this project: the more information we have, the better we can develop and target solutions for supporting Oregon’s heritage sector over the next 10 years.

Additional Survey Background:
This study is an update to the 2011 Heritage Vitality Study which resulted in identifying issues impacting heritage preservation work across the state and made recommendations that led to focused initiatives and technical assistance. To learn more about some of the outcomes that followed that study visit here<https://www.oregon.gov/oprd/OH/Pages/tools.aspx#2024ohv>. The 2024 Oregon Heritage Vitality Study is a partnership between Oregon Heritage and the University of Oregon’s Institute for Policy Research and Engagement.
